Divergence Insufficiency Esotropia Associated with Excessive Near Work During the Coronavirus Pandemic
This study reports four adolescents with divergence insufficiency esotropia, characterized by significant distance deviation, linked to excessive near work during COVID-19 lockdown. All cases, with an average age of 14, were successfully treated with bilateral lateral rectus resection, correcting 25 to 40 PD deviations without overcorrection, suggesting that increased near work and reduced outdoor activities may contribute to this condition.
ABSTRACT Purpose The COVID-19 lockdown has had a profound impact on people’s lifestyles – especially the youth – through school closures and home confinement. Accordingly, the excessive use of smartphones and digital devices made adolescents vulnerable to the adverse effects of excessive near work on the eyes. Method Four adolescents (10–17 years) with acute acquired divergence insufficiency esotropia were evaluated. Results The mean age of our patients was 14 years old (10–17). Their mean deviation at distance was 32.5 PD (25–40 PD), and their mean near deviation was 13 PD (8–20 PD). All patients had normal neurological examinations and exhibited normal brain and orbital MRI results. Excessive near work with digital devices such as smartphones after the COVID-19 lockdown was the only risk factor identified. All cases were successfully treated with bilateral lateral rectus resection. A 3.5- to 5.5-mm bilateral lateral rectus resection corrected 25 to 40 PD esotropia at distance without overcorrection at near. Conclusion Decreased outdoor activities and excessive near work during the COVID-19 pandemic could be associated with divergence insufficiency esotropia in adolescents. Bilateral lateral rectus resection is an acceptable surgical treatment.

Background and PurposeTo report on the outcomes of treating children with a persistent esotropia with an injection of botulinum toxin in a medial rectus muscle.Patients and MethodsThe medical records were reviewed of all children at one institution with a persistent esotropia after bilateral medial rectus recessions and bilateral lateral rectus resections then treated with a botulinum toxin injection.ResultsFive patients with a mean preoperative esotropia of 37Δ (range 25-50Δ) underwent bilateral medial rectus recessions and then bilateral lateral rectus resections. Their residual esotropia (mean of 25Δ; range 18-35Δ) was then treated with a single injection of 3-5 units of botulinum toxin into one medial rectus muscle. The patients were then followed for a mean of 34 months (range 14-79 months). At last follow-up, two patients had an esotropia <10Δ. The other three patients had no long-term improvement in their ocular alignment. Two of these patients then underwent additional strabismus surgery. In both cases, they then developed a consecutive exotropia.ConclusionTreatment with a single injection of botulinum toxin was beneficial in 2 of 5 children. Botulinum toxin treatment alone did not result in a consecutive exotropia in any patients treated.

Unilateral or bilateral lateral rectus resection is commonly performed for the correction of residual esotropia, but few results have been reported. Twenty-eight patients with residual esotropia underwent bilateral lateral rectus (BLR) resection. Six months after operation (n = 25), there were 17 (68%) successful cases, 7 (28%) cases of undercorrection, and 1 (4%) case of overcorrection. The success rate at the 24th postoperative month (n = 11) was 72.7%. The success rate for cases of infantile esotropia (n = 18) was higher than that for acquired esotropia (n = 7) at the 6th postoperative month (p = 0.156). The results were not significantly affected by the presence of other deviations (p = 0.387), the performance of other surgery (p = 0.393), the presence of amblyopia (p = 1.00), or the amount of residual esotropia (p = 0.604). Performance of BLR resection in patients with residual esotropia after bilateral medial rectus (BMR) recession is considered appropriate due to its high success rate and provision of a stable alignment during two-year follow up.

The purpose of this study is to explore the relationships between excessive near work and divergence insufficiency esotropia in young adults. A prospective study described a series of young patients with divergence insufficiency esotropia related to excessive near work between 2012 and 2017. The medical records of twelve young patients with divergence insufficiency esotropia and a history of excessive near work were reviewed, and the duration of near work, angle of primary position deviations at distance and at near, and angle of primary position deviations after refraining from near work for 3 months were analyzed. All patients with divergence insufficiency esotropia (age range: 21–35 years) showed an initial esodeviation ranging from 18 to 35 prism diopters for distance fixation and ranging from 8 to 20 prism diopters for near. Neurological evaluation in all cases was normal. Myopic refractive errors were detected in twelve patients. Every patient persisted near work for more than 6 h a day over a period of several months (minimum 4 months). Reductions in esodeviation were noted in twelve patients after refraining from near work for more than 3 months. Only one patient was diplopia free in all positions of gaze. The remaining eleven patients were treated successfully, six with prisms and five with surgery. They were all orthophoric and demonstrated restored binocularity at the post-treatment examinations. Our findings suggested that excessive near work might influence the development of divergence insufficiency esotropia in young adults. Refraining from excessive near work could decrease the degree of esodeviation in these patients.

Previous studies show that parents play a critical role in developing adolescents’ excessive media use. However, few studies have been conducted on the effect of parental depression on adolescents’ excessive smartphone use. Thus, this study aimed to investigate whether perceived parental depression can predict adolescents’ excessive smartphone use and whether adolescents’ psychological problems, such as depression and anxiety, account for the association between perceived parental depression and adolescents’ excessive smartphone use from a sample of 1,156 adolescents. The hypothesized model was tested using hierarchical regression and the PROCESS macro (Model 4). Hierarchical regression analysis showed that perceived parental depression positively predicts adolescents’ excessive smartphone use. Additionally, mediation analyses revealed that the effects of perceived parental depression on adolescents’ excessive smartphone use were mediated by adolescents’ depression and anxiety. The results provide evidence of the direct effect of perceived parental depression on adolescents’ excessive smartphone use and the indirect effects of adolescents’ depression and anxiety on this relationship. These results have meaningful implications from the theoretical and applied perspectives. The directions for future research are also discussed.

Objective To investigate the relationship between excessive use of smartphone and acute acquired comitant esotropia (AACE). Methods The data of 30 cases with AACE between Feb. 2016 and Jan. 2018, and the data of 4 cases with AACE between Feb. 2009 and Jan. 2011 and 4 cases with AACE between Feb. 2011 and Jan.2013 were retrospectively reviewed. Results Among 30 patients in observation group, there were 24 cases who used smartphone for more than 5h a day. Diplopia occurred after several months. There were 9 cases among 24 cases used smartphone for more than 8 h a day, and diplopia occurred after excessive use of smartphone for a long time. Conclusion Excessive use of smartphone can promote AACE development in susceptible people. Key words: Comitant esotropia, acute, acquired; Smartphone; Use, excessive

Excessive smartphone use has recently attracted researchers’ attention. Previous studies have suggested that state anxiety and motivations are important predictors of excessive smartphone use. However, few studies have investigated how motivations and state anxiety interact with each other, and the subsequent impact on excessive smartphone use. In the current study, based on the Compensatory Internet Use theory, we analyzed the moderating role of state anxiety on the relationship between two types of motivations (i.e. entertainment and social interaction) and excessive smartphone use. Using the Smartphone Addiction Scale for College Students (SAS-C), Smartphone Usage Motivation Scale and State Anxiety Scale (S-Anxiety), we investigated 600 Chinese college students who identified themselves as smartphone users. Results indicated that: (1) for the high smartphone-use group, state anxiety moderates the relationship between entertainment and social interaction motivations and excessive smartphone use; (2) for the low smartphone-use group, state anxiety does not moderate the relationship between entertainment and social interaction motivations and excessive smartphone use. Our study emphasized the importance of psychological well-being variables (i.e. anxiety in this study) in facilitating excessive smartphone use, and may provide guidance for the design of interventions targeted at people suffering from excessive smartphone use.

BackgroundExcessive smartphone use is a new and debated phenomenon frequently mentioned in the context of behavioral addiction, showing both shared and distinct traits when compared to pathological gaming and gambling.ObjectiveThe aim of this study is to describe excessive smartphone use and associated factors among adolescents, focusing on comparisons between boys and girls.MethodsThis study was based on data collected through a large-scale public health survey distributed in 2016 to pupils in the 9th grade of primary school and those in the 2nd grade of secondary school. Bayesian binomial regression models, with weakly informative priors, were used to examine whether the frequency of associated factors differed between those who reported excessive smartphone use and those who did not.ResultsThe overall response rate was 77% (9143/11,868) among 9th grade pupils and 73.4% (7949/10,832) among 2nd grade pupils, resulting in a total of 17,092 responses. Based on the estimated median absolute percentage differences, along with associated odds ratios, we found that excessive smartphone use was associated with the use of cigarettes, alcohol, and other substances. The reporting of anxiety and worry along with feeling low more than once a week consistently increased the odds of excessive smartphone use among girls, whereas anxiety and worry elevated the odds of excessive smartphone use among boys. The reporting of less than 7 hours of sleep per night was associated with excessive smartphone use in all 4 study groups.ConclusionsThe results varied across gender and grade in terms of robustness and the size of estimated difference. However, excessive smartphone use was associated with a higher frequency of multiple suspected associated factors, including ever having tried smoking, alcohol, or other substances; poor sleep; and often feeling low and feeling anxious. This study sheds light on some features and distinctions of a potentially problematic behavior among adolescents.

Excessive smartphone use has recently become a topic of interest. Prior studies have suggested that psychological well-being variables and motivations are important predictors of excessive smartphone use. However, few have examined the internal mechanism of these factors in leading to excessive smartphone use. Based on Compensatory Internet Use theory, we investigated the moderating role of psychological resilience between two types of motivation — escapism and social interaction — and excessive smartphone use. Selecting 576 typical smartphone users, we found: (1) Escapism motivation and psychological resilience significantly correlate with excessive smartphone use, whereas social interaction motivation does not; (2) Psychological resilience moderates the relationship between both escapism and social interaction motivation and excessive smartphone use. Our study demonstrates the mechanism of different types of motivation and the protective effect of psychological resilience on excessive smartphone use. Thus, we emphasize resilience training that would help train people to be able to cope with life problems more effectively.

Although excessive smartphone use has been confirmed as being associated with specific representations of mental health (e. g., anxiety, depression, wellbeing, etc.) throughout the COVID-19 pandemic, the relationship between excessive smartphone use and cognitive representations of mental health (i.e., psychological safety) is not yet fully understood. This study aimed to identify the association between excessive smartphone use and psychological safety among university freshmen during the COVID-19 pandemic; in addition, we examined the mediation effects of hardiness and interpersonal distress in this relationship. In this study, 1,224 university freshmen were selected at random from several universities in Guizhou Province of China. The Psychological Safety Scale was used to evaluate the mental health of university freshmen; the Mobile Phone Dependence Scale was used to evaluate excessive smartphone use; the Hardiness Questionnaire was used to evaluate hardiness; and the Interpersonal Relation Synthetic Diagnose Test was used to evaluate interpersonal distress. The findings showed that: (1) the greater the degree of excessive smartphone use, the more serious respondents' interpersonal distress and the lower their hardiness; (2) excessive smartphone use was not only directly related to the psychological safety of university freshmen but also indirectly related to their psychological safety through the independent mediation of hardiness and interpersonal distress, as well as through the chain mediation of hardiness and interpersonal distress. In general, excessive smartphone use in university freshmen could lead to a decline in their psychological safety. Also, hardiness and interpersonal distress play a complex role in this relationship. During the COVID-19 pandemic, interventions on the mental health of college freshmen should not only provide guidance on how to use their smartphone responsibly but also to provide them with support and guidance for the enhancement of their hardiness and improvement of their interpersonal relationships.

Problematic smartphone use is the excessive use of the smartphone with negative impacts on the quality of life of the user. We investigated the association between social anxiety and excessive smartphone use. The sample consisted of 140 participants, 73 male and 67 female university students with a mean age of 26 years and 4 months (SD = 3.38), who filled in the Liebowitz Social Anxiety Scale and the Smartphone Addiction Scale (SAS). Results showed a positive association between social anxiety and excessive smartphone use. Social anxiety explained 31.5% of the variance of ratings on the SAS. A second study investigated the interaction between abstinence and sensation seeking and excessive smartphone use. The sample consisted of 60 participants, 44 female and 16 male university students. The sample was divided into two experimental conditions: 30 participants were abstinent for 1.5 h from the smartphone and 30 participants were non-abstinent. Results showed that excessive smartphone use increased in the group that abstained compared to those who did not. Secondly, participants who had high baseline sensation-seeking ratings had higher scores of excessive smartphone use after abstinence compared with those with low ratings of sensation seeking. These studies indicate the contribution of social anxiety to problematic smartphone use and how it can be exacerbated by the combination of abstinence and high sensation seeking.

IntroductionPrevious studies have demonstrated that impulsivity is positively correlated with excessive smartphone use, indicating the involvement of frontal lobe circuits. This study examined excessive smartphone use, impulsivity, and mental wellbeing in patients with acquired brain injury (ABI) before and after occupational rehabilitation treatment, and control participants.ProcedureParticipants consisted of 44 patients with ABI [10 patients with orbitofrontal syndrome (OFS) and 34 without OFS] and 69 control participants with no history of brain injury. The procedure included a smartphone application that tracked daily smartphone use and frequency of device unlocks, computerized tasks that evaluated impulsive choice (Delay Discounting Task), impulsive action or response inhibition (the ability to stop an already-initiated action—the Go/No-Go task), and questionnaires measuring excessive smartphone use, obsessive–compulsive symptoms [Yale–Brown Obsessive–Compulsive Scale (YBOCS)], impulsivity [Barratt Impulsiveness Scale (BIS-11), which measures non-planning, motor and attention impulsivity], and mental wellbeing [Depression, Anxiety, and Stress Scale (DASS-21), which measures depression, anxiety, and stress]. Data were collected at two time points: baseline (T1) and 5 months later (T2).ResultsAt baseline (T1), patients with ABI and OFS exhibited higher impulsive action, indicated by more commission errors on the Go/No-Go task, excessive smartphone use, and higher ratings of depression compared with control participants. Secondly, patients with ABI without OFS showed higher trait attention-impulsivity ratings compared with control participants. After treatment (T2), patients with ABI showed improved impulsive choice, indicated by improved delay discounting, but no improvement in smartphone use.DiscussionBrain injury, particularly in frontal regions, is associated with impulsiveness and excessive smartphone use. Patients with ABI showed an improvement in delay discounting after treatment, which is likely due to occupational therapy and training in control of impulsivity. It is recommended that specific treatment program for excessive smartphone use will be developed for patients with ABI.

Background In current days, smartphone use is inevitable in everyday life and has increased drastically over recent decades not only in adults but also in adolescents. Even though smartphone provides convenience and produces personal pleasure, the potential causable problems due to excessive smartphone use (ESU) of adolescents have been reported continuously. As ESU of adolescents became one of the important social issue, the connection between specific personality traits and ESU is being studied continuously. Aims & Objectives This study explored whether altered resting state functional connectivity (rsFC) is related to personality traits and other psychological factors in adolescents demonstrating ESU compared to healthy controls (HCs). Methods Thirty six adolescents (38.7%) were prone to ESU and fifty seven adolescents were HCs. Smartphone Addiction Proneness Scale for Adolescents (S-scale) was used to measure ESU and adolescent version of temperament and character inventory (JTCI) was used to measure personality traits in this study. For rsFC analysis, the left and right central executive network (CEN), the salience network (SN) and default mode network (DMN) were included in the analysis in order to investigate the brain networks related to personality traits that impact ESU. In addition, orbitofrontal cortex (OFC), midcingulate cortex (MCC) and nucleus accumbens (NAcc), which are related to reward processing and cognitive control, were included in the analysis in order to examine the brain networks related to temperament and character subscales of TCI that influence ESU. Results Mean scores of ESU adolescents were lower in persistence than HCs. In addition, HCs group had a positive correlation with novelty seeking and a negative correlation with persistence in bivariate correlation analysis. However, ESU group had no significant correlation with TCI personality traits. In the rsFC, ESU group showed lower functional connectivity in brain regions related to the salience network compared with HCs. ESU showed lower connectivity between the left middle cingulate cortex (MCC) and left superior parietal lobule, and between the left MCC and left postcentral gyrus. In addition, lower connectivity between the left posterior cingulate gyrus and right precentral gyrus and between the left orbital frontoinsula and right precentral gyrus were shown in ESU. Discussion & Conclusions This study suggests that smartphone proneness was associated with low persistence in terms of temperament and it was engaged in neurofunctional alterations.
